Output 56a21e68c5cb52510e11099a3e6b7010af7a9496633a303827e6b21b67e6a0b7:2

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ac4940d0013a0ee84618cc4f1645ca56e874d965 OP_EQUAL
address
3HPyuFwJPYhYpJN6SMXfjx2L1AshLCZ8gE
transaction
56a21e68c5cb52510e11099a3e6b7010af7a9496633a303827e6b21b67e6a0b7
spent
true